## Tame the flaky DNS lookups in Pondworks gateway

Hey on-call — lookups were randomly timing out because we hammered the resolver with zero jitter. This adds retry jitter, a small negative-cache TTL, and a fallback resolver. Should cut those 3am pages way down. The knobs you might need to tweak live below.

tuning constants:
QUOTAS = {
    "druwyn": 5,
    "holix": 5,
    "zorath": 5,
    "holwyn": 10,
}

Hey, welcome to the Ledgerkite review! Quick context on our billing worker: we run blue-green deploys through the Switchyard controller. Green gets the new build, we replay a shadow copy of live billing events against it, and only flip traffic once invoice totals match for 30 minutes. Rollback is just flipping back to blue — no data migration happens mid-deploy, so it's safe. To inspect the deploy audit trail yourself, authenticate to Switchyard with the reviewer credential below.

app token of yajeg-kawef = kto11_7En3XSX8xQw

// IDEMPOTENCY_KEY_TTL_SECONDS
//
// Payment retries through the Tollbooth gateway must reuse the same
// idempotency key for 24h. Shorter TTLs caused duplicate charges during
// the Brimford incident; longer ones bloat the dedupe table. Do not
// change without sign-off from payments-core. The regression test pins
// behavior against the reference build noted below.

pipeline stamp: htk4_ae36

Hey Marisol — handing off the spreadsheet export thing before I head out. Quick summary for support: big exports in Tallyforge spike memory because we buffer the whole workbook before streaming. Fix is half-shipped; exports over 50k rows may still OOM until next release. Tell customers to split files for now. Full workaround steps are on the internal page here.

dashboard of tawef-yageg = https://jira.torvaworks.corp/deploy/merge_requests/board/settings/issue/settings/build/86c86b97dff3e2041bd6f497